The Bass Coast Shire Council is now inviting applications for its Shopfront Improvement Rebate Program to assist eligible organisations to renew their shopfront to improve the vibrancy of individual shops, stimulate economic growth and enhance the look and feel of local commercial districts.
The Shopfront Improvement Rebate Program will assist businesses and service providers in Bass Coast to improve the appearance of their shopfronts and outdoor spaces. Vibrant and attractive streets, shops, and public spaces play a key role in creating prosperous town centres.
Some examples of the works that can be completed as part of the program include:
- External signage and A-frames
- Improved accessibility
- Replacement of outdoor furniture and umbrellas
- Planter boxes, fencing and display of goods infrastructure
- Painting of the shopfront/façade
- Minor repairs to structural façade elements, awnings, and verandas
- Installation of store lighting visible from the street
Funding Information
- Applicants can seek 100% of the total project cost, up to $2,000 inclusive of GST (a maximum of $500 exclusive of GST can be attributed to landscaping). A contribution by the submitting organisation is not required, however will be viewed positively during the assessment.
- Multiple approved works can be funded in one application up to the allocated funding. Applicants can ask for up to $2,000 for their project.

What can’t be funded?
- Building, local laws and planning application costs
- Application fees
- Business marketing or promotion (except for signage)
- Operational or administrative costs
- Works started before applications close on 23 October 2022.
- Projects based outside of Bass Coast
Eligibility Criteria
- An applicant must:
- Be a small business that employs 10 or less full-time equivalent* employees or have an aggregated turnover of less than $1 million.
- Operate a business that has street facing shopfront or footpath trading or can demonstrate high foot or vehicle traffic or potential for growth.
- Be a properly constituted legal entity and willing to accept legal and economic responsibility for the investment.
- Submit professional invoices for the activity;
- Hold appropriate permits from Council departments for project.
- Not have a financial debt with Council, including any previous unacquitted grants. Please note, businesses on payment plans with Council will be considered.
- Not be a Local, State and Federal Government agency or department. Be based within the municipality of Bass Coast.
Note: Full Time Equivalent (FTE) is not headcount. 1 FTE is considered 38 hours of work over a week’s period. If 1 part-time employee works 20 hours per week and another part-time employee works 18 hours per week, both employees equal 1 FTE.
